WebThe Buddhist Jataka Tales and the Sanskrit Panchatantra, from ancient India, are amongst the oldest collection of fables known to us today. Other well-known collections from the ancient world include Aesop’s fables from Greece, and the fables of Phaedrus from Rome. While many of the best-known fables are indeed ancient in origin, the form still survives today in … WebApr 11, 2015 · The Panchatantra of ancient India is a collection of fables, originally written in Sanskrit. It has five distinct sections, each of which is focused on a specific principle, and is believed to have been written by Vishnu Sharma. WebOct 1, 2007 · Two men were traveling in a company through a forest, when, all at once, a huge bear crashed out of the brush near them. One of the men, thinking of his own safety, climbed a tree. The other, unable to fight the savage beast alone, threw himself on the ground and lay still, as if he were dead.
